Goals & Services

 

The goals for our therapeutic riding program are to help children and adults gain relationship skills, increase their self-esteem, gain self-awareness while having fun learning basic horsemanship skills. We focus on the client’s approach to problem solving life skills with an emphasis on exploring and learning new healthy life skills. We offer a holistic approach to mental health. We provide individual, couple and family, group and individual sessions. We provide “traditional talk” counseling services as well.

ESP — Equine Specialized Psychotherapy

Mended Hearts is located in a beautiful rural setting  for your equine sessions.  Mended Hearts has seven horses to choose from for your therapy. We have horses in many different sizes to accommodate all age groups.  Some clients create a special bond with one horse that they wish to work with each session and other clients prefer to  rotate between all the horses.  Either way we are sure that you will enjoy the equine therapy experience.

Mended Hearts has an outdoor arena and large pasture that is used for riding when the weather is favorable. When inclement weather moves in your session will be held in our indoor arena. This arena is heated during the winter months eliminating a disruption in your therapy program.

Play Therapy

Mended Hearts offers several different types of play therapy. We have one room  dedicated to play. Toys for all ages are available for children to use while in a session. Mended Hearts also has a sand tray, complete with accessories if a child chooses sand therapy. And of course there is our beautiful outdoors that is often the “office” of choice for our younger clients. Catching butterflies, looking for frogs, or digging in our sand hill are just a few of the activities to enjoy during a session.

Day Camps and Field Trips

Day Camps

Every year Mended Hearts holds a day camp for teen age girls (15-18) who are current clients. Activities, which vary from year to year  include, but are not limited to, improving social skills, attendance of horse shows in the area, learning about horse/stable management and care. These are activities that increase the participant’s knowledge of horse riding, stable care and enhance developmental skills, self-confidence and responsibility.
